> So what's the problem? TYPO3 is a tool for outputting HTML. Your task
> is to figure out how to output the appropriate HTML. The nice thing
> about the internet is that when you see something you like, you can
> *look at the source* and figure out how it was done.
>
> Go back and look at that page, there are a bunch of js files included
> in the head, a small inline script, there's probably some relevant
> styles in the site's stylesheet, and there's a block of images like
> this:
>
> <div id="carousel">
>        <a href="images/imagebox/bw1.jpg" title="Moon eclipse"
> rel="imagebox"><img src="images/carousel/th_bw1.jpg" width="100%" /></a>
>        <a href="images/imagebox/bw2.jpg" title="Rain drops"
> rel="imagebox"><img src="images/carousel/th_bw2.jpg" width="100%" /></a>
>        <a href="images/imagebox/bw3.jpg" title="Church" rel="imagebox"><img
> src="images/carousel/th_bw3.jpg" width="100%" /></a>
>        <a href="images/imagebox/lights1.jpg" title="City lights"
> rel="imagebox"><img src="images/carousel/th_lights1.jpg" width="100%" /
>  ></a>
>        <a href="images/imagebox/lights2.jpg" title="Flash lights"
> rel="imagebox"><img src="images/carousel/th_lights2.jpg" width="100%" /
>  ></a>
>        <a href="images/imagebox/lights3.jpg" title="Laser lights"
> rel="imagebox"><img src="images/carousel/th_lights3.jpg" width="100%" /
>  ></a>
> </div>
>
> You should be able to do a job like this quite quickly with Typoscript
> and an FCE ('flexible content element'), or you could also write an
> extension to do it. But there is not an extension or readymade
> solution for every problem.
